Understanding the Core Mechanics and Strategic Thinking

At its heart, the gameplay centers on probability and deduction. Each square on the grid represents a potential mine or a safe zone. As you reveal squares, the game provides clues in the form of numbers indicating how many mines are adjacent to that square. This information is crucial for narrowing down the possible locations of hidden explosives. A square with '1' next to it means there's one mine in the surrounding eight squares; '2' indicates two, and so on. Experienced players learn to interpret these numbers to pinpoint safe areas and avoid risky clicks. Utilizing this basic information effectively is vital for prolonged success and maximizing your score.

The Role of Probability in Safe Zone Identification

Probability isn't just a mathematical concept; it’s a practical skill in this type of game. While you can’t definitively know where a mine is located without revealing it, you can assess the likelihood of a square being safe based on the surrounding clues. For example, if a square has a number ‘1’ and is adjacent to seven revealed safe squares, the remaining square is almost certainly a mine. Understanding and applying these probabilistic calculations dramatically increases your chances of uncovering a larger number of safe squares. The Art of Flagging and its Importance

Flagging suspected mine locations is a crucial component of effective gameplay. Flags serve as visual markers, preventing accidental clicks on potentially dangerous squares. More importantly, they help you track your deductions and identify patterns. A well-placed flag can also reveal information about the surrounding squares. By strategically flagging potential mines, you effectively reduce the number of unknown squares and increase your overall understanding of the minefield. Don’t underestimate the power of a well-considered flagging strategy; it’s often the difference between a successful run and a swift defeat.

The Impact of Loss Aversion on Decision-Making

Loss aversion, a well-documented psychological phenomenon, plays a significant role in how players approach the game. The pain of losing all progress is often more emotionally impactful than the pleasure of gaining an equivalent reward. As a result, players may become more cautious as they advance, prioritizing risk avoidance over potential gains. This can lead to suboptimal strategies, as the fear of losing outweighs the desire to maximize their score. Recognizing the influence of loss aversion is crucial for maintaining a rational mindset and making informed decisions, even under pressure. The Evolution of the Mines Game and its Enduring Popularity

The origins of the minesweeper-style game can be traced back to the 1970s, but its widespread popularity exploded with its inclusion in Microsoft Windows in the 1990s. This accessibility introduced the game to millions of players, establishing it as a classic time-killer and a staple of the personal computing experience. Over the years, numerous variations and adaptations have emerged, ranging from simple browser-based versions to more elaborate mobile games with enhanced graphics and features. Despite the proliferation of modern gaming options, the core gameplay loop remains remarkably compelling, and the simplified form of a mines demo game continues to attract a dedicated following.
